YG Discusses Kendrick Lamar's Advice on Quality Control Ahead of 'The Gentlemen's Club' Album Release

By

Mosi Reeves

2h ago· 6 min readen

Summary

In an interview, rapper YG discusses a conversation with Kendrick Lamar about artistic integrity and quality control, reflecting on his own past of releasing albums just to fulfill his contract with Def Jam. The article covers YG's renewed focus on his craft with his seventh album 'The Gentlemen's Club', marking a shift in his approach to music-making and his career under his new label 10K Projects through his 4Hunnid imprint.
